We are seeking a compassionate and dedicated Speech-Language Pathologist (SLP) to join our team at Emerald Care Center Southwest , a leading skilled nursing facility. The SLP will be responsible for evaluating, diagnosing, and treating speech, language, communication, and swallowing disorders in our diverse resident population.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in geriatric care, excellent interpersonal skills, and a commitment to improving the quality of life for our residents.

Responsibilities :

  • Assessment and Evaluation :

o Conduct comprehensive evaluations to assess speech, language, cognitive

communication, and swallowing disorders.

o Develop individualized treatment plans based on assessment results and resident needs.

  • Treatment and Intervention :
  • o Implement and monitor therapeutic interventions to improve communication skills and swallowing functions.

    o Adapt treatment techniques to meet the specific needs and goals of each resident.

  • Documentation and Reporting :
  • o Maintain accurate and up-to-date records of resident progress, treatment plans, and clinical notes.

    o Prepare detailed reports and communicate effectively with the interdisciplinary team, residents, and their families.

  • Collaboration and Teamwork :
  • o Work closely with other healthcare professionals, including nurses, physicians, occupational therapists, and physical therapists, to provide holistic care.

    o Participate in care planning meetings and contribute to the development of care strategies for residents.

  • Education and Training :
  • o Provide education and training to residents, families, and staff on speech, language, and swallowing disorders.

    o Stay current with best practices and advancements in the field of speech-language pathology.

  • Compliance and Standards :
  • o Adhere to facility policies, state, and federal regulations, and professional standards of practice.

    o Ensure all practices comply with healthcare and safety regulations.

    Qualifications :

  • Master’s degree in Speech-Language Pathology from an accredited program.
  • Current licensure as a Speech-Language Pathologist in Oklahoma.
  • Certification of Clinical Competence in Speech-Language Pathology (CCC-SLP) from the American Speech-Language-Hearing Association (ASHA) preferred.
  • Experience in a skilled nursing or geriatric setting is highly desirable.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to work effectively with residents, families, and interdisciplinary teams.
  • Compassionate, patient-centered approach to care and a commitment to improving the quality of life for residents.
